Output d44128830796b6737abf5c6df5a3c4c7ef83524ab80e41c95248cb61f5a17cf1:0

value
506060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d4da2d6393c0e8f66595c2cbadf14dc5ff7f85 OP_EQUAL
address
39hRhU36NzbiziMQnme1e9VjLvSGzWZMa5
transaction
d44128830796b6737abf5c6df5a3c4c7ef83524ab80e41c95248cb61f5a17cf1
spent
true